Essential Information to Include

Basic Details

Begin your obituary by announcing the death with fundamental information about the deceased. Include their full name, age, date of birth, date of death, and place of death. Whilst the cause of death is optional, ensure you have the family’s permission before including such sensitive information.​

Biographical Information

The main body of your obituary should celebrate the deceased’s life through meaningful details. Consider including their place of birth, family background, educational achievements, career highlights, hobbies and interests, military service (if applicable), religious beliefs, community involvement, and personal characteristics that defined them.​

Family Connections

List surviving family members such as partners, children, siblings, and grandchildren, as well as those who predeceased them. This information helps readers understand the deceased’s family connections and relationships within the community.​

Funeral Service Details

Provide complete information about the funeral or memorial service, including the date, time, location, and any specific instructions for attendees. If you’re accepting charitable donations in lieu of flowers, include clear instructions on how to contribute and which organisations to support.​

Structure and Tone

Obituaries can range from brief and formal to detailed and lighthearted, depending on the deceased’s character and your intended audience. Whilst there’s flexibility in style, maintain a respectful tone that appropriately honours the deceased’s memory and achievements.​

Length and Content

Keep your obituary balanced by including only the most meaningful details rather than attempting to list everything. Focus on information that helps readers picture who the deceased was and their impact on their community, family, and friends.​

Template Structure

A typical obituary follows this structure: announcement of death with basic details, followed by a paragraph about their life covering education, career, family, and achievements, then surviving family members, and finally funeral service information. This template provides a clear framework whilst allowing personalisation.​

Proofreading and Verification

Critical Details to Check

Before submitting your obituary, thoroughly proofread all content to ensure accuracy. Verify that the funeral date and time are correct, all names are spelled correctly, donation instructions are accurate and complete, and contact information is current.​
